1000’s line streets in Israel for Bibas household funeral procession

By Editorial Board Published February 26, 2025 4 Min Read
Share
1000’s line streets in Israel for Bibas household funeral procession

1000’s of mourners in Israel have gathered on the streets for the funeral procession of Shiri Bibas and her two younger sons.

Ms Bibas, 32, was kidnapped with four-year-old Ariel, and nine-month-old Kfir from the Niz Or kibbutz throughout Hamas’s assault on Israel in October 2023.

Hamas launched their our bodies final week as a part of the Gaza ceasefire take care of Israel, although initially the militant group didn’t launch the proper physique for Ms Bibas – inflicting outrage.

The physique of the Israeli mother-of-two was finally launched and positively recognized.

Hamas has claimed they had been killed in an Israeli airstrike. Israel denies this and says they had been killed by their captors.

The youngsters’s father, Yarden Bibas, who was taken hostage individually from his household, was freed on 1 February.

His spouse and youngsters will likely be buried close to Niz Or kibbutz throughout a personal ceremony on Wednesday.

The three will likely be buried subsequent to Ms Bibas’s dad and mom, who had been additionally killed within the assault.

Kfir was the youngest of about 30 kids kidnapped by Hamas.

The toddler, with pink hair and a toothless smile, rapidly grew to become well-known throughout Israel. His ordeal was raised by Israeli leaders on podiums all over the world.

The physique of journalist and peace activist Oded Lifshitz, who was 83 when he was kidnapped, was additionally repatriated similtaneously the Bibas household.

Hamas handed over the stays as a part of the ceasefire settlement reached with Israel final month that is seen residing Israeli hostages swapped with Palestinian prisoners.

The 4 our bodies had been transferred in black coffins in a rigorously orchestrated public show involving dozens of armed Hamas militants – which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u described as “despicable”, and UN human rights chief Volker Turk mentioned was “cruel” and “inhumane”.

Round 1,200 folks in Israel had been killed within the 7 October Hamas assault that triggered the battle in Gaza, and 251 had been taken hostage.

Greater than 48,000 Palestinians have been killed in Gaza, based on the Gaza well being ministry, which doesn’t differentiate between combatants and civilians.
